为何会出现服务器访问失败的情况?

小贝
预计阅读时长 5 分钟
位置: 首页 抖音 正文

服务器访问失败可能由多种原因引起,以下是一些常见的原因及其详细解释:

服务器访问失败

1、网络连接问题

网络中断:服务器的网络连接可能由于各种原因中断,如网络设备故障、网络拥堵或ISP问题,这会导致服务器无法与客户端或其他网络设备通信。

延迟或丢包:网络延迟或数据包丢失也可能导致访问失败,这些问题可能是由于网络不稳定、路由器配置错误或物理线路问题引起的。

2、DNS解析问题

DNS服务器故障:如果DNS服务器无法将域名解析为正确的IP地址,服务器访问就会失败,可以尝试使用其他DNS解析服务器或清除本地DNS缓存来解决此问题。

域名配置错误:域名解析配置错误,如错误的A记录或CNAME记录,也会导致访问失败。

3、防火墙设置问题

服务器访问失败

防火墙阻止访问:服务器的防火墙可能设置为禁止对某些端口或IP地址的访问,以增加安全性,如果防火墙规则过于严格,可能会阻止正常的访问请求。

安全组配置错误:对于云服务器,安全组配置错误也可能导致访问失败,需要确保安全组规则允许所需的端口和IP地址通过。

4、服务器故障

硬件故障:服务器的硬件组件(如硬盘、内存、电源等)可能出现故障,导致服务器无法正常运行。

软件错误:操作系统崩溃、服务进程崩溃或应用程序错误也可能导致服务器访问失败。

资源限制:服务器的资源(如CPU、内存、存储空间)不足,无法处理请求,也会导致访问失败。

5、配置错误

服务器访问失败

防火墙配置错误:防火墙配置错误导致某些端口被屏蔽,从而无法访问服务器。

域名解析配置错误:域名解析配置错误导致无法找到服务器的正确IP地址。

Web服务器配置错误:Web服务器(如Apache、Nginx)配置错误,导致无法正确处理HTTP请求。

6、安全策略限制

访问控制列表(ACL):安全策略可能限制了某个IP地址或用户组的访问。

防火墙规则:防火墙规则可能阻止了某个IP地址或用户组的访问。

7、响应超时

服务器负载过重:服务器在一段时间内无法响应客户端的请求,可能是由于服务器负载过重、网络延迟或较慢的处理能力引起的。

8、浏览器或客户端问题

浏览器缓存问题:浏览器缓存可能导致访问旧版本的网页或资源,从而出现访问失败的情况。

客户端网络配置问题:客户端的网络配置错误(如DNS设置错误、代理服务器配置错误)也可能导致无法访问服务器。

服务器访问失败可能由多种原因引起,包括网络连接问题、DNS解析问题、防火墙设置问题、服务器故障、配置错误、安全策略限制、响应超时以及浏览器或客户端问题,在遇到服务器访问失败时,建议逐一排查这些可能的原因,并采取相应的解决措施。

以上内容就是解答有关“服务器访问失败”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。

-- 展开阅读全文 --
头像
如何优化App服务端的图片存储策略?
« 上一篇 2024-11-26
如何实现分析日志的超快速度?
下一篇 » 2024-11-26
取消
微信二维码
支付宝二维码

发表评论

暂无评论,1人围观

目录[+]